Job Description

Senior Software Engineer, Platform

Omada Health

• You will become a key part of the development and operation of Omada’s digital health program Architecture & Infrastructure. • You will play a daily role building and scaling our platform one piece at a time, supporting our delivery of a personalized experience to program members, while empowering our health coaches to deliver effective interventions • You will work closely (including pair programming) with the rest of the Platform team, collaborating frequently with internal customers from our product engineering teams, InfoSec, IT, and beyond • You will build cross-functional relationships with software engineers, data engineers, and technical program managers to understand their needs, and to deliver solutions to improve their working lives • You will manage highly available services in our EKS clusters and on standalone EC2 hosts, with a modern approach to designing for resiliency and cross-regional redundancy • You will work with engineers to design and improve developer tooling and capability, supporting use cases like secrets management, automations, cloud environments, and access management • You will mentor and guide the professional and technical development of team members. • You will maintain and enhance our self-hosted Gitlab-based VCS and CI/CD infrastructure.

Job Requirements

  • 5+ years of working experience designing and building diverse AWS cloud architectures
  • Experience building and operating a Kubernetes cluster
  • Experience with Terraform and Ansible
  • Experience working with Datadog application performance monitoring, custom metrics, and logs
  • Experience managing, configuring, and troubleshooting persistent virtual Linux hosts and volumes
  • Experience building, deploying, and orchestrating Docker images and containers.
  • Great communication skills – both written and verbal. Skilled at writing documentation for others.
  • Readiness to run towards fires as part of an on-call rotation.
